What are the benefits of using LED grow lights for indoor plants?

Using LED grow lights for indoor plants offers numerous advantages that can enhance your gardening experience.

Energy Efficiency

LED grow lights consume less energy compared to traditional lighting systems, making them a cost-effective choice for indoor gardening. They generate minimal heat, reducing the need for additional cooling costs.

Customizable Light Spectrum

LED grow lights can be tailored to emit specific light wavelengths, which allows you to cater to the unique needs of different plants. By providing the right spectrum, you can encourage better growth and flowering.

Longevity

Unlike conventional bulbs, LED grow lights have a longer lifespan. They can last up to 50,000 hours, reducing the frequency and cost of replacements, ensuring your plants receive consistent light.

Low Heat Emission

With less heat production, LED lights allow you to position them closer to plants without the risk of overheating. This is especially beneficial for seedlings and sensitive species that thrive under specific light conditions.

Eco-Friendly

LED technology is more environmentally friendly. They contain no toxic elements and are recyclable, making them a sustainable option for indoor growers who are conscious of their ecological footprint.

In summary, LED grow lights not only enhance plant growth but also save energy, reduce costs, and are easier on the environment, making them a perfect choice for indoor gardening enthusiasts.

How do LED grow lights compare to traditional grow lights?

Grow lights are essential for indoor gardening, allowing plants to thrive in the absence of natural sunlight. Among the various options available, LED grow lights and traditional grow lights (such as fluorescent and incandescent) have gained popularity. Understanding their differences can help you make an informed decision for your indoor garden.

Energy Efficiency

LED grow lights are well-known for their energy efficiency. They consume significantly less electricity compared to traditional grow lights, which can lead to reduced energy bills. This efficiency is not only beneficial for your wallet but also for the environment.

Longevity

Another significant advantage of LED grow lights is their lifespan. LEDs can last up to 50,000 hours compared to only 10,000 hours for traditional lights. This longer lifespan means less frequent replacements and less waste over time.

Heat Emission

When it comes to heat generation, LED grow lights are cooler to the touch than traditional grow lights. This reduces the risk of overheating your plants, providing a safer growing environment without the need for additional cooling systems.

Spectrum Control

LED grow lights offer better control over the light spectrum. They can be designed to emit specific wavelengths that benefit plant growth, such as blue and red light. Traditional grow lights, while effective, generally provide a broader spectrum that may not be as tailored for plant needs.

Cost

While the initial investment for LED grow lights can be higher than traditional grow lights, their energy efficiency and longer lifespan often result in cost savings over time. Many indoor gardeners find that the benefits outweigh the initial costs.

In conclusion, LED grow lights are increasingly becoming the preferred choice for indoor gardening due to their energy efficiency, longevity, lower heat emissions, and tailored light spectrum. Whether you’re a hobbyist or a commercial grower, making the switch to LED could be a game-changer for your gardening success.

What factors should I consider when choosing LED grow lights?

Choosing the right LED grow lights can significantly impact your plant's growth and overall yield. Here are some key factors to consider when making your decision:

1. Light Spectrum

Different plants require different light spectra for optimal growth. Look for full-spectrum LED lights that can support plants during all growth stages.

2. Wattage

Wattage indicates how much power the light consumes. Higher wattage usually means brighter light, but also consider the size of your grow area to ensure proper light distribution.

3. Energy Efficiency

LED lights are generally more energy-efficient than traditional lights. Check the lumens per watt rating for efficiency, which can help save on electricity costs in the long run.

4. Heat Output

LED grow lights produce less heat than other types of lights. Consider how much heat your chosen lights emit, as excessive heat can damage plants or increase cooling costs.

5. Lifespan

Look for products that offer a long lifespan, usually around 50,000 hours or more. A longer lifespan means less frequent replacements and increased reliability.

6. Price

Finally, set a budget for your LED grow lights. While it's tempting to go for cheaper options, investing in high-quality lights can yield better results in the long term.

What is the optimal light spectrum for indoor plant growth?

Indoor plants thrive when they receive the right light spectrum. Different wavelengths of light affect plant growth in various ways. Generally, the optimal light spectrum for indoor plant growth includes a combination of red and blue light.

Red Light

Red light (620-750 nm) is crucial for flowering and fruiting. It encourages photosynthesis and helps plants produce energy. Using red light during the flowering stage can enhance yields and promote vibrant blooms.

Blue Light

Blue light (450-495 nm) plays a significant role in vegetative growth. It helps in leaf development and encourages sturdy stems. Providing adequate blue light during the early growth stages ensures healthy, robust plants.

Full Spectrum Light

Full spectrum grow lights combine both red and blue wavelengths, mimicking natural sunlight. They are ideal for indoor gardening as they support all growth stages. Consider using LED grow lights, which are energy-efficient and provide a full spectrum.

Conclusion

For optimal indoor plant growth, use grow lights that provide a balanced spectrum of red and blue light. Full spectrum options can support your plants through all their growth stages, ensuring a thriving indoor garden.

How can I maximize the efficiency of my LED grow lights?

Maximizing the efficiency of your LED grow lights is essential for achieving optimal plant growth. Here are some simple tips to help you get the most out of your lighting setup:

Choose the Right Spectrum

Select LED grow lights that offer a full spectrum suitable for your plants. Different growth stages require different light spectrums. For example, blue light encourages vegetative growth, while red light is ideal for flowering.

Position Lights Properly

Ensure your LED lights are positioned correctly to provide even coverage. Hanging lights at the right height will prevent light burn and ensure your plants receive the intensity they need.

Maintain Optimal Temperature

Monitor the temperature in your growing area. LEDs generate less heat than traditional lights, but it’s still important to ensure your setup stays within ideal temperature ranges for plant growth.

Use Reflective Materials

Enhance light distribution by using reflective materials in your grow space. Walls painted white or covered with Mylar can bounce light back to your plants, maximizing exposure.

Regular Maintenance

Keep your LED grow lights clean and well-maintained. Dust and debris can block light output, reducing efficiency. Regularly wipe down your lights to ensure they perform at their best.

By following these tips, you can enhance the efficiency of your LED grow lights, leading to healthier plants and better yields.
